Hadith 1790
حَدَّثَنَا
قُتَيْبَةُ، حَدَّثَنَا
مَالِكُ بْنُ أَنَسٍ، عَنْ
عَبْدِ اللَّهِ بْنِ دِينَارٍ، عَنْ
ابْنِ عُمَرَ، أَنّ النَّبِيَّ صَلَّى اللَّهُ عَلَيْهِ وَسَلَّمَ سُئِلَ عَنْ أَكْلِ الضَّبِّ فَقَالَ : " لَا آكُلُهُ وَلَا أُحَرِّمُهُ " ، قَالَ : وَفِي الْبَاب ، عَنْ عُمَرَ ، وَأَبِي سَعِيدٍ ، وَابْنِ عَبَّاسٍ ، وَثَابِتِ بْنِ وَدِيعَةَ ، وَجَابِرٍ ، وَعَبْدِ الرَّحْمَنِ بْنِ حَسَنَةَ ، قَالَ أَبُو عِيسَى : هَذَا حَدِيثٌ حَسَنٌ صَحِيحٌ وَقَدِ اخْتَلَفَ أَهْلُ الْعِلْمِ فِي أَكْلِ الضَّبِّ فَرَخَّصَ فِيهِ بَعْضُ أَهْلِ الْعِلْمِ مِنْ أَصْحَابِ النَّبِيِّ صَلَّى اللَّهُ عَلَيْهِ وَسَلَّمَ وَغَيْرِهِمْ وَكَرِهَهُ بَعْضُهُمْ ، وَيُرْوَى عَنْ ابْنِ عَبَّاسٍ ، أَنَّهُ قَالَ : " أُكِلَ الضَّبُّ عَلَى مَائِدَةِ رَسُولِ اللَّهِ صَلَّى اللَّهُ عَلَيْهِ وَسَلَّمَ وَإِنَّمَا تَرَكَهُ رَسُولُ اللَّهِ صَلَّى اللَّهُ عَلَيْهِ وَسَلَّمَ تَقَذُّرًا " .
´It is narrated from Abdullah bin Umar (may Allah be pleased with them both) that` the Prophet (peace and blessings of Allah be upon him) was asked about eating the dhab (monitor lizard)? He replied: "I neither eat it nor do I declare it unlawful." 1؎. © Imam Tirmidhi says:
1- This hadith is Hasan Sahih,
2- In this chapter, there are also ahadith from Umar, Abu Sa'id Khudri, Ibn Abbas, Thabit bin Wadi'ah, Jabir, and Abdur Rahman bin Hasnah (may Allah be pleased with them all),
3- There is a difference of opinion among the scholars regarding eating dhab; some of the scholars among the Companions have given concession,
4- And some have considered it disliked. It is narrated from Ibn Abbas (may Allah be pleased with them both), he says: Dhab was eaten at the dining spread of the Messenger of Allah (peace and blessings of Allah be upon him), and the Messenger of Allah (peace and blessings of Allah be upon him) left it due to natural aversion.
